    I am trying to find exciting Eid decorations, to put up for Eid, we have never had those growing up because I grew up mostly in Islamic countries and the decorations were every where. Now that Eid seems to fall along these pagan holidays, my youngest niece is really enamored by them, I am so fearful in her mind that she'll confuse christmas for Eid or something. We had different traditions for Eid when I was young for instance we got 'Eidya' which is money and new Eid clothes, but because the boxes beneath the tree are every where, we try to get the kids presents, the older niece and nephew of course understand the value and meaning of Eid but I don't think my niece has made that distinction yet, so please help me find nice Eid decorations, my google search is really bad..     I'm not from the US but anywayyy.....If these decorations are for the benefit of the youngsters then why dont you get together with them one evening and make the decorations at home, together? At least that way you can explain the importance of Eid to them aswell insha'Allah? Actually that would be quite cute.

    You can make Eid cards, banners, streamers and blow up balloons and decorate/write on them yourselves and on top of that you can make fairy cakes and ice them with the words 'Eid Mubarak', Yum!

    We decorate with christmas lights I buy after that holiday for 75% off I also make my own banners and blow up balloons and hang crepe paper. I'm also saving up to purchase star lanterns like these - http://www.paperlanternstore.com/starlamps.html

    I think it's really important to create family traditions as well. Here in minnesota, muslims go to the mall of america each eid. The science museum also offers a discount on eid, so a lot of muslims go there as well. Make a special breakfast that you only make on eid (home made cinnamon rolls are tasty and a personal favorite at my house). And, make an eid cake for the evening (nothing says holiday like a sugar overload).
